About this fabric

The image shows a softly translucent ivory textile, warmed by delicate beige threads rather than a stark white ground. Fine vertical lines and an airy, irregular weave create gentle surface movement, while the folds alternate between luminous highlights and deeper honeyed shadows. This lightweight appearance makes the cloth particularly suited to fluid window treatments that allow light to pass through. Weave Avorio is catalogued as a Fabric in Dedar’s Fire-retardant collection; no composition, width, rub-test or additional performance features are supplied in the record.

How to use it

Use this warm ivory colourway for full-length curtains or relaxed sheers where filtered daylight and a softly layered look are wanted. It pairs naturally with pale timber, chalky walls and other warm neutral furnishings.
